A war bride returns to her small Icelandic hometown in The Seagull's Laughter (2001). Agga (Ugla Egilsdóttir) is a precocious 11-year-old who watches with equal parts mistrust and amazement as her cousin Freyja (Margrét Vilhjálmsdóttir), who left their provincial hometown years before as a plump teen with no prospects, return home in a flurry of laughter and perfume. Freyja has transformed herself into a glamorous and sophisticated woman, and claims to have been married to an American soldier killed in WWII; everyone in town is enchanted by the sexy widow in red, so Freyja sets out on a mission to find husband #2.
